Drain Pipe and Hose Identification

To ensure the proper functioning of your washing machine, it’s essential to locate and identify the drain pipe and hose correctly. This will help you avoid potential issues, such as clogs and water damage, down the line.

A standard washing machine uses a drain hose or pipe to expel wastewater from the machine. The hose is typically connected to the bottom rear of the washer and the other end is usually hooked to a household drain or a dedicated laundry drainage system.

In the case of a high-efficiency washing machine, things can be a bit different. High-efficiency (or HE) machines use a specialized drain hose that’s designed to handle the machine’s unique flow and pressure characteristics.

Troubleshooting Drain Issues

How to Drain a Washing Machine Full of Water (7 Steps)

When faced with issues related to clogged drain hoses and pipes in a GE washing machine, it is essential to understand the common causes and implement effective troubleshooting steps to resolve the problems. Clogs can be a result of kinks in the hose, mineral buildup, or blockages in the pipe.

Common Causes of Drain Issues

  • Kinks in the drain hose: These can be caused by improper installation, bending, or twisting of the hose.
  • Mineral buildup: Over time, minerals in hard water can deposit on the inner surface of the drain hose and pipes, leading to clogs.
  • Blockages in the pipe: Grease, hair, and other debris can accumulate in the pipe, causing blockages.

Using a Drain Snake or Plumber’s Auger

If you suspect that the clog is caused by a kink in the hose or a blockage in the pipe, using a drain snake or plumber’s auger can be an effective solution. These tools allow you to physically remove the blockage from the drain hose or pipe.

  1. Before using a drain snake or plumber’s auger, make sure to turn off the power to the washing machine and disconnect the drain hose from the back of the machine.

  2. Feed the drain snake or plumber’s auger into the drain hose or pipe until it reaches the clog. Rotate the tool as you push it further into the pipe to break up any mineral buildup or debris.

  3. Once the clog is removed, rinse the drain hose and pipe thoroughly to ensure that all debris is cleared.

Leveling and Installation

Proper leveling of your washing machine is vital for its optimal performance and to prevent potential imbalances that could cause damage to the machine or surrounding surfaces.

To ensure a stable installation, it’s recommended to use the built-in levelers provided by the manufacturer. These levelers help to adjust the machine to the desired level, preventing any vibration or movement that may occur during the wash cycle. Proper leveling also contributes to quieter operation, reduced energy consumption, and minimized wear and tear on the machine’s components.
